I came across a story about the young donkey that got the unique opportunity to carry Jesus Christ on its back, during the Lord's triumphant entry into Jerusalem. The donkey was overjoyed and proud during that journey because he thought that all the praises, 'Hosanas 'and excitement of the crowd were directed towards him. The donkey could not sleep that night thinking of the grand reception he got. Next day morning, the donkey went 'alone' through the same streets expecting a similar royal reception. But the children who waved palm leaves the day before made fun of the donkey .He was beaten up and dumped into a ditch. Lying there with broken legs, he might have thought about the reason for this difference in reception.
